1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What are the components of a nucleotide?

Back

A nucleotide is made up of three components: a sugar molecule, a phosphate group, and a nitrogen base.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What shape did Watson and Crick propose DNA has?

Back

Watson and Crick proposed that DNA has the shape of a double helix.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the function of tRNA in protein synthesis?

Back

tRNA (transfer RNA) carries amino acids to the ribosome during protein synthesis.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What type of RNA is responsible for carrying genetic information from DNA to the ribosome?

Back

mRNA (messenger RNA) carries genetic information from DNA to the ribosome.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What organelle is known as the site of protein translation?

Back

The ribosome is the organelle where protein translation occurs.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What are the four nitrogen bases found in DNA?

Back

The four nitrogen bases in DNA are adenine (A), thymine (T), cytosine (C), and guanine (G).

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the role of rRNA in the cell?

Back

rRNA (ribosomal RNA) is a component of ribosomes and plays a crucial role in protein synthesis.
